@charset "UTF-8";
/* CSS Document */
/*   
Theme Name: Marko Slavnic
Theme URI: http:// 
Description: For the use of Marko Slavnic
Author: Carina Javier 
Author URI:  http://kstudiofx.com/ 
Version: 1.0 
. 
This theme is for the use of Marko Slavnic only. It is not to be redistributed or resold in any way.
. 
*/ 

body {
	margin:0px; padding:0px;/* FOOTER COLOR */
	background:#000000 url(http://markoslavnic.com/wp-content/themes/MARKOSLAVNIC/images/menubg.jpg) repeat-x;/* BG MAIN COLOR and or IMAGE color code is: background-color:#333333; */
	font-family:Arial, Helvetica, sans-serif;
	color:#FFFFFF;
	font-size:13px;
	line-height:19px;
	text-align: justify;
}


.alignleft {
   display: inline;
   float: left;
}
.alignright {
   display: inline;
   float: right;
}
.aligncenter {
   display: inline;
   float: center;
}

#footer {
	background-image:url(http://markoslavnic.com/wp-content/themes/MARKOSLAVNIC/images/footerbg.jpg);/* FOOTER IMAGE */
	background-repeat:no-repeat;/* REPEATS FOOTER IMAGE HORIZONTALLY */
	background-position:center top;
	color:#FFFFFF;/* FOOTER CONTENT COLOR */
	padding:20px 0 0 0 ;/* MOVES FOOTER CONTENT DOWN FOR SPACING */
	min-height:125px;
	font-weight:lighter;
}

.container {
	width:100%;
	margin:0 auto;
  	position:relative;/* BECAUSE THIS IS RELATIVE THE MENU CAN BE ABSOLUTE AND RIGHT TO KEEP IT RIGHT ALIGNED WHEN ADDING MORE PAGES */
}

.containerfoot {
	width:940px;
	margin:0 auto;
  	position:relative;/* BECAUSE THIS IS RELATIVE THE MENU CAN BE ABSOLUTE AND RIGHT TO KEEP IT RIGHT ALIGNED WHEN ADDING MORE PAGES */

}
.containerbody {
	width:940px;
	margin:0 auto;
  	position:relative;/* BECAUSE THIS IS RELATIVE THE MENU CAN BE ABSOLUTE AND RIGHT TO KEEP IT RIGHT ALIGNED WHEN ADDING MORE PAGES */
}
#header {
	padding-top:0px;/* MOVES LOGO & MENU DOWN */
}
#logoimg h1, #logoimg small {
	margin:0px;
	display:block;
	text-indent:-9999px;
}
#logopattern {
	background-image:url(http://markoslavnic.com/wp-content/themes/MARKOSLAVNIC/images/headerbgslice.jpg);
	background-repeat:repeat-x;
	width:100%;
	height:130px;
	margin:0 auto;
  	position:relative;
	top:0px;

}
#logobg {
   	background-image:url(http://markoslavnic.com/wp-content/themes/MARKOSLAVNIC/images/headerbg.jpg);
	background-repeat:no-repeat;
	background-position:center top;
	width:100%;
	height:130px;
	margin:0 auto;
  	position:relative;
	}

#logoimg {
    background-image:url(http://markoslavnic.com/wp-content/themes/MARKOSLAVNIC/images/logo.png);
	background-repeat:no-repeat;
	width:358px;
	height:105px;
	position: relative;
   	top: 10px;
   	z-index: 1;
   	margin:0 auto;
   }
   
#menubg {
	background-image:url(http://markoslavnic.com/wp-content/themes/MARKOSLAVNIC/images/menubars.png);
	background-repeat:no-repeat;
	width:740px;
	height:94px;	
  	margin:0 auto;

}
ul#menu {
	clear:left;
	float:left;
	list-style:none;
	margin:0;
	padding:0;
	position:relative;
	text-align:center;
	top: 10px;
	left: 50%;	
}
ul#menu li {
	display:block;
	float:left;
	list-style:none;
	margin:0;
	padding:0 25px 0 25px;
	position:relative;
	right:50%;
}
ul#menu li.shortfilms {
	display:block;
	float:left;
	list-style:none;
	margin:0;
	padding:0 10px 0 10px;
	position:relative;
	right:50%;
}
ul#menu li a {
	display:block;
   margin:0 0 0 1px;
   padding:3px 10px;
   text-decoration:none;
   outline:none;
   line-height:1.3em;

}
ul#menu li a.active, ul#menu li a:hover {
	
}
/* Fix up IE6 PNG Support */
#logo {
	behavior: url(scripts/iepngfix.htc);
	
}

/* 
	Text-Styles   
*/

h2 {
	margin:0px 0px 10px 0px;
	font-size:24px;
	font-family:Helvetica, Arial, Sans-serif;
	color:#FFFFFF;
	font-weight:lighter;
}
small {
	color:#FFFFFF;
	font-weight:bold;
	font-size:11px;
	display:block;
	margin-bottom:15px;
}
a {
	color:#FFFFFF;/* FOOTER & CONTENT LINK COLOR */
	font-weight:lighter;
	text-decoration:none;
}
a:hover {
	color: #00a8d4;
}
p { margin: 0px 0px 15px 0px; }

a.button {
	background:#32312f url(http://markoslavnic.com/wp-content/themes/MARKOSLAVNIC/images/button_bg.jpg) repeat-x;/* BUTTON */
	padding:5px 10px 5px 10px;
	color: #ffffff;
	text-decoration: none;
	border:1px solid #32312f;
	text-transform:uppercase;
	font-size:9px;
	line-height:25px;	
}
a.button:hover {
	background:#667f7f url(http://markoslavnic.com/wp-content/themes/MARKOSLAVNIC/images/button_bg_o.jpg) repeat-x;/* BUTTON ROLLOVER */
	border-color:#214341;
}

/* 
	Block-Styles 
*/

.block {
	margin-bottom:20px;
}
.blockbg {
	background-image:url(http://markoslavnic.com/wp-content/themes/MARKOSLAVNIC/images/shine.png);
	background-repeat:no-repeat;
	background-position:center top;
}
.block_inside { 
	display:block; 
	border:0px solid #ffffff;

	width:940px;
	margin:0 auto;
  	position:relative;
	margin-bottom:20px;
}


.text_block {
	float:left;
	width:430px;
	margin-left:30px;
}

.block {
	border:0px solid #a3a09e;
	background-image:url(http://markoslavnic.com/wp-content/themes/MARKOSLAVNIC/images/still1.jpg);
	background-repeat:no-repeat;
	background-position:center top;
	min-height: 259px;
	margin-bottom:20px;
	position:relative;
}
.block2 {
	border:0px solid #a3a09e;
	background-image:url(http://markoslavnic.com/wp-content/themes/MARKOSLAVNIC/images/still2.jpg);
	background-repeat:no-repeat;
	background-position:center top;
	min-height: 252px;
	margin-bottom:20px;
	position:relative;
}
.block3 {
	border:0px solid #a3a09e;
	background-image:url(http://markoslavnic.com/wp-content/themes/MARKOSLAVNIC/images/still3.jpg);
	background-repeat:no-repeat;
	background-position:center top;
	min-height: 253px;
	margin-bottom:20px;
	position:relative;
}
.ribbon {
	position:absolute;
	top:-3px;
	right:-3px;
}
/*
	Portfolio-Home-Styles
*/

#block_portfolio {
	overflow:auto;
	margin-bottom:20px;
}
#portfolio_items {
	width:605px;/* WIDTH OF RECENT PROJECTS BOXES */
	margin-right:25px;
	float:left;
	padding-top:3px;
}
#text_column {
	float:right;
	width:310px;
	background:none; 
	padding:5px 5px 5px 5px; 
}
#text_column h2#text_title { 
	text-indent:-9999px;
	background-repeat:no-repeat;
	width:310px;
	height:129px;
}

.mini_portfolio_item {
	border:1px solid #a3a09e;
	margin-bottom:10px;

}
.mini_portfolio_item .block_inside { 
	background:none; background-color:#FFFFFF; 
	padding:25px 30px 15px 30px; 
}
.mini_portfolio_item .thumbnail { float:left; margin-right:20px; border:1px solid #979390; }

.mini_portfolio_item {
	border:1px solid #a3a09e;
	margin-bottom:10px;
	position:relative;
}
/*
	Footer-Styles
*/

#footer {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:10px;
	font-weight:lighter;
	
}

#footer .long {

	text-align:right;
	font-size:10px;
}
#footer h3 {
	color:#FFFFFF;
	text-transform:uppercase;
	font-size:10px;
}
.footer_column ul li, .footer_column ul {
	list-style:none;
	margin:0px;
	padding:0px;
}
/*
	Blog
*/


h2 {
	margin:0px 0px 10px 0px;
	font-size:24px;
	font-family:Helvetica, Arial, Sans-serif;
	color:#FFFFFF;
	line-height:39px;
	letter-spacing:-1px;
	font-weight:lighter;
}
/*
	Block-Content-Styles
*/

#block_content {
	width:940px;
	margin:0 auto;
  	position:relative;
	padding-bottom:25px;

}

#patient41 {
	width:1080px;
	margin:0 auto;
  	position:relative;
	padding-bottom:25px;


}


#content_area {
	width:940px;
}

#content_area h2 { font-size:32px; line-height:31px; }

#content_area .separator {
	border-top:1px solid #00a8d4;
	margin-top:40px;
	padding-top:40px;
}
h4 {
	color:#FFFFFF;/* SUBTITLE ABOVE MAIN BIG TITLE COLOR */
	margin:0px 0px 0px 0px;
	font-weight:lighter;
}


/* ============================================= */
/* safe settings                                 */

/* add display:inline to floated elements */
.alignleft,
.alignright,
ul#menu,
ul#menu li,
.text_block,
#portfolio_items,
#text_column,
.mini_portfolio_item .thumbnail {display:inline;}

/* convert min height values */
#footer {height:125px;}
.block {height:259px;}
.block2 {height:252px;}
.block3 {height:253px;}


/* add zoom:1 to pos:relative elements */
.container,
#logopattern,
#logobg,
#logoimg,
ul#menu,
ul#menu li,
.block,
.block_inside,
.block2,
.block3,
.mini_portfolio_item,
.containerfoot,.containerbody,#block_content {zoom:1;}

/* add display:inline to floated elements */
*:first-child+html .alignleft,
*:first-child+html .alignright,
*:first-child+html ul#menu,
*:first-child+html ul#menu li,
*:first-child+html .text_block,
*:first-child+html #portfolio_items,
*:first-child+html #text_column,
*:first-child+html .mini_portfolio_item .thumbnail {display:inline;}

/* convert min height values */
*:first-child+html #footer {height:125px;}
*:first-child+html .block {height:259px;}
*:first-child+html .block2 {height:252px;}
*:first-child+html .block3 {height:253px;}


/* add zoom:1 to pos:relative elements */
*:first-child+html .container,
*:first-child+html #logopattern,
*:first-child+html #logobg,
*:first-child+html #logoimg,
*:first-child+html ul#menu,
*:first-child+html ul#menu li,
*:first-child+html .block,
*:first-child+html .block_inside,
*:first-child+html .block2,
*:first-child+html .block3,
*:first-child+html .mini_portfolio_item,
*:first-child+html .containerfoot, *:first-child+html .containerbody, *:first-child+html #block_content {zoom:1;}
